About this listen
Completely frustrated with the predictability of his town, 14-year-old Jason Miller finds himself totally bored, until Ethan, Jason's friend, suddenly dies and Jason quickly discovers that his peaceful town and the town doctor are up to something horribly evil. Complicating matters is Jason's discovery that he is the son of aliens who stayed on earth following a botched invasion mission.
©1996 Neal Shusterman (P)2000 Listening LibraryCritic Reviews
"Ultimately, the book asks readers to examine the question of what it means to be truly human. This is great science fiction. It's fun to read and thought-provoking at the same time." (School Library Journal)
